    I had racing pigeons for a great part of my youth, and then picked it up again in my mid 20's 30's and early 40's. Fantastic sport, but life just got to busy, and condo living is not conducive to flying pigeons unfortunately. I flew in the CJC in New Jersey, and when I flew as a kid maybe 600 lofts for YB season. As I flew thru my middle age, maybe 250 lofts, tops. I would notice, and a lot of the "old-timer's" would concur on this, that it seemed when you would get a real nice clear day in late November/early December, with strong winds from the west or even northwest or southwest, you would get birds back from the YB series of races in August and September. I remember one day one year in early December some years back, I got three birds back on the same day. One was lost during training and the others were lost during the race schedule in September. The two birds lost during the races, still had there counter-marks on. The theory was that the birds almost instinctively knew winter was coming and they needed to stop "bumming around". lol Interestingly, the weather got much worse almost immediately after the birds returned home. I was always in awe at how smart our racing pigeons were...

    How do they know where home is?

    • @Rocky.Ridge.Pigeons
      @Rocky.Ridge.Pigeons  ปีที่แล้ว +1

      I think they use a combination of skills to find home. but to get them started in the right direction I think they use the earths magnetic field. then the suns poition combined with the Time of day. then when they are within 20 miles of home they can pretty much go by memory of the landscape. but nobody really knows for sure I have a theory about their eyes but it’s not worth mentioning because I can’t prove anything.
